Insights: News Releases Kilpatrick Townsend Grows Tech Transactions Practice
Linda Judge Joins Silicon Valley Office
SILICON VALLEY (February 16) – Kilpatrick Townsend & Stockton announced today the addition of Linda Judge to the firm's Silicon Valley office. Ms. Judge will be joining the firm as Counsel and a member of the firm’s Mergers & Acquisitions and Securities Team.
"Linda is an outstanding addition to the firm's corporate team in Silicon Valley," said Rich Cicchillo, Kilpatrick Townsend’s Team Leader for its Mergers & Acquisitions and Securities Practice. "Her vast experience and exceptional background in commercial and technology transactions, particularly involving intellectual property assets both in-house and in the law firm setting, is a fantastic complement to our existing emerging companies and intellectual property practices.” We look forward to working with Linda and welcome her to the firm."
Prior to Kilpatrick Townsend, Ms. Judge served as Director and Corporate Counsel at Affymetrix. At Affymetrix, she was responsible for a range of intellectual property (IP) related matters, including freedom-to-operate analysis, patent and trademark prosecution and portfolio analysis, strategic planning, due diligence, and licensing support.
Ms. Judge has extensive experience representing companies in simple and complex transactions in numerous industries, with an emphasis on biotechnology, pharmaceuticals, diagnostics, cleantech and medical device technologies. She served in a legal or scientific capacity with several biotechnology companies including Theravance Biopharma, LS9, Inc., AcelRx Pharmaceuticals, Cell Genesys, SyStemix Inc., and Genelabs, Inc. Ms. Judge’s law firm experience includes work as a partner at an AmLaw 50 firm where she worked on both corporate and patent matters.
Ms. Judge earned her J.D. from Santa Clara University. She received her M.S. in Environmental Chemistry from the University of California, Berkeley and her B.S. in Chemistry and B.A. in Biology from California State University, Sonoma.
